[Java] java.lang 패키지와 유용한 클래스

Yujeong·2024년 4월 21일
0

Java

목록 보기
1/22
post-thumbnail

java.lang 패키지란?

  • lang: Language의 줄임말
  • 자바 언어를 이루는 가장 기본이 되는 클래스들을 보관하는 패키지
  • 자바 애플리케이션에 자동으로 import 된다.

java.lang 패키지의 대표적인 클래스들

  1. Object: 모든 자바 객체의 부모 클래스
    [Java] Object 클래스
  2. String: 문자열
    [Java] 불변 객체(Immutable Object)
    [Java] String 클래스
  3. StringBuilder: 가변 문자열을 생성하고 조작하는 클래스
    [Java] StringBuilder 클래스
  4. Wrapper: 래퍼 클래스, Integer, Long, Double 등의 기본형 데이터 타입을 객체로 만든 것
    [Java] Wrapper 클래스
  5. Math: 수학 계산
    [Java] Math 클래스
  6. Class: 클래스 메타 정보
    [Java] Class 클래스
  7. System: 시스템과 관련된 기본 기능들을 제공
    [Java] System 클래스
  8. StringBuffer: StringBuilder와 유사하지만, 동기화된 클래스

유용한 클래스들

  1. Random: 난수 생성
    [Java] Random 클래스
  2. regex: 정규 표현식 지원

참고
Package java.lang

profile
공부 기록

0개의 댓글

관련 채용 정보